Willie James Obituary

Willie Daniel James was born on June 9,1942 and departed this life on January 19, 2025.

He was born to Ha e Mae Houston James and Willie James in Pavo, Georgia. Willie professed his faith at an early age.

He leaves to cherish his memory, his wife, Alice James, his children (Tiffany Monique James, Nikia Dean, Daren Alonzo James, Willie Daniel James, Jr.) and a sister, Joann James Goldwire and 10 grandchildren (Christopher(deceased), Elijah, Daren, Jr., Darius, Brandon, Trinity, Taavis, Duwaani, Danjjal, & Jaylen), and 11 great grandchildren and a host of nieces and nephews.

Preceding him in death are his parents, siblings (Easter Mae James Jones, Sylvester James, Martha Anne James Thompson, & Bethina James Brown), and 3 children (Denise James, Willie Dean James, and Kema Dean.)

Willie hosted “The Simply Daniel Radio Ministry” on 1330 AM radio and was awarded the David Adams Award for “Outstanding Service in Gospel Music”. He was a staff member at the Boston Globe and worked in healthcare for many years. He was a carpenter and general contractor with his own company, W. James Contract ng. Willie sang with several gospel groups during his life, Edna Gallmon Cooke, The Disciples with Lenny Cox, His own group, The God Squad, and Louis Johnson & The Swan Silver tones.
